Investigative Reporter

Nexstar Media Group, Inc. · Wilkes-Barre, PA · 2 wk ago
On-siteMarketingFull-time

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in communication/journalism or related degree required
  • Three (3-5) years television reporting experience required
  • History with investigative and long form story production
  • Solid vocal delivery, camera presence, and clear enunciation
  • Strong reporting skills
  • Understanding of and experience with CTV and OTT platforms and producing distinct content for them
  • Excellent reading, writing, spelling, grammar and organizational skills
  • Promotes teamwork and maintains attitude of cooperation with all station personnel

Skills

  • Operate newsroom computer systems

Responsibilities

  • Produce content for multiple platforms, including TV, internet, mobile, etc.
  • Work with management to enterprise and develop stories daily
  • Demonstrate compelling storytelling using dynamic live shots and stand-ups, creative graphics, and use of digital and social media platforms
  • Organize material, determine angle or emphasis, and write stories according to prescribed editorial style and format standards
  • Gather and verify information regarding stories through interview, observation and research
  • Works with management team to develop on investigative stories
  • Produces investigative stories following Nexstar standards guidelines
  • Build network of sources who supply information that allows the company to stay ahead of its competitors
  • Perform special projects and other duties as assigned
